1 Sports Nutrition Lesson 12 Supplements

2 Supplements and Health What is a dietary supplement? A food product added to the total diet that contains at least one of the following ingredients: vitamin, mineral, herb, botanical, amino acid, metabolite, constituent, extract, combination of these ingredients.

3 Supplements A supplement is something added, particularly to correct a deficiency such as Vitamin C. Many dietary supplements contain substances other than essential nutrients. They are marketed to increase the total dietary intake of some food or plant substance.

10 Will supplements improve my health? They are advertised to improve some facet of health. They are regulated by the FDA. Do they work? Well……………………….Maybe

11 Supplements The American Dietetic Association says that the best nutritional strategy for promoting health and reducing the risk of chronic disease is to wisely choose a wide variety of foods. They also say that supplements can help meet these needs in certain cases.

12 Supplements What are these cases? Elderly Women of childbearing age Vegans Strict Weight Loss Diets

13 Supplements It is important that you do not exceed the upper limits of some vitamins and minerals.

14 Supplements Things to know about supplements. -they can be marketed without testing -they can make any claim but that they will prevent, treat or cure a specific disease. -they often misrepresent research -the government must prove that the claims they make are false

15 Supplements Advice -Buy standardized products manufactured in the US with a Nutrition Facts Panel -Use only single ingredient supplements. -Keep a record of the effects -Stop taking them if you experience any problems.

16 Supplements Can supplements harm my health? -nutrition is only one factor that influences health. If people rely on a supplement they may neglect lifestyle behaviors such as exercise.

17 Supplements -The may provide a false sense of security to people who use them as substitutes for a healthful diet. -Large doses of a single nutrient can have a harmful effect. While they may prevent some things they will cause other problems.

18 Supplements -People may rely on supplements rather than quality medical advice. -Supplements vary widely in quality. Studies have shown that they may or may not contain the main ingredient and often contain things not listed on the label. This can pose a health risk.

19 Supplements -Many studies have shown that various supplements may harm health and may even be fatal. The use of ephedrine- containing supplements for weight loss have resulted in death. http://www.pph-net.org/fenphen-fen-phen- fen.htm
